K2 requires that every consequential action in a DAV involves three substrates: the mechanical layer (L1 smart contract), the AI layer (DAV VM / specialist agent), and the mortal layer (human wallet signature). All three are required. No two of three suffice.

K2 operates differently for natural persons vs. DAVs:

Entity TypeSigning MechanismConstitutional Role
Natural PersonK2 — single human private keySovereign boundary. Human signs. Human decides.
DAV (Distributed Autonomous Corp)PRISM — n-of-m constitutional multisigNo single actor. Consensus gates. No K2 for entities.

The critical distinction:

  • K2 protects the individual from the organism
  • PRISM protects the organism from any single actor

K2 does not exist for DAVs. A DAV IS a PRISM. The consensus IS the signature.


Three Substrates

SubstrateLayerRoleExample
L1 MechanicalSmart contractEnforces invariants, executes atomic logicLombard Bridge liquidation
DAV VMAI agentAnalyzes, recommends, executes within laneAPU Council deliberation
MortalHuman walletSigns, approves, bears ultimate responsibilityOwner approves trade

The adversarial relationship between substrates is intentional:

  • The DAV VM (specialist) optimizes for the organism's objectives.
  • The wallet's frontier model (generalist) represents the owner's broader interests.
  • The human signature mediates conflicts between the two.

No substrate trusts the others. Each checks the others. This is not redundancy -- it is adversarial verification.

Private DAV: Human Signs Everything

In a Private DAV, K2 is maximally simple:

  • One human, one wallet. The owner is the sole mortal substrate.
  • No delegation. Target design: the owner would sign every transaction. No agent could act without the owner's explicit approval (frozen claim until reconciliation complete).
  • No Lane A governance. There are no other ZAI holders to vote. The owner IS the governance.
  • Agent role: The DAV VM suggests actions (e.g., APU's Council recommends a trade). The owner reviews and signs. Or does not.

Flow

DAV VM analyzes situation
--> Generates recommendation
--> Presents to owner (Approve / Hold)
--> Owner signs with wallet key
--> L1 executes the signed transaction

If the owner does not sign, nothing happens. The organism waits. This is sovereignty.

Organizational DAV: Natural-Person Council Governs

In an Organizational DAV, K2 scales to collective governance:

  • Multiple ZAI holders. Each holds a fraction of the 100 ZAI and participates in governance.
  • Lane A allocation. ZAI holders vote on how the 38.2% operational share is distributed among agents, departments, and initiatives.
  • Agent wallets. Agents (human or AI) have their own wallets. They receive SKY streams via FlowWallet and operate within their voted allocation.
  • Board-level bind (public DAV). Consequential actions (treasury movements, large trades, parameter changes) require ≥2 distinct natural-person councilors to bind the exact consequence; PRISM verifies the receipt only and never signs.

Flow

Agent (DAV VM) identifies opportunity
--> Checks: within my Lane A allocation?
--> If yes: executes within budget (FlowWallet cap enforced)
--> If no: escalates to Lane A vote
--> ZAI holders / councilors deliberate
--> If approved: ≥2 natural persons bind exact consequence; PRISM verifies
--> L1 executes only that exact bound consequence

FlowWallet Streams Continuously

This is the critical distinction from traditional corporate treasury:

  • Revenue does not accumulate in a pool waiting for quarterly distribution.
  • FlowWallet streams SKY to every agent and equity holder continuously, every block.
  • An agent's budget is not a lump sum. It is a rate: "X SKY per block, not to exceed Y total."
  • If Lane A reallocates, the stream adjusts immediately. No waiting period.
